SMPP Sessions
Session Establishment
To initiate communication, an ESME must establish a session with the SMSC using a binding process. This process involves authentication and authorization to ensure that only legitimate ESMEs can connect to the SMSC. The ESME uses a bind request along with its system_id (username) and password to authenticate.
As we already know SMPP defines three types of binding modes for establishing sessions.
When a bind request is sent, the SMSC responds with a bind response to confirm whether the authentication was successful. Upon successful binding, a session is established, allowing the ESME to exchange PDUs with the SMSC.
SMPP Session States
An SMPP session can exist in one of the following states:
Sign in to read the full article
Start innovating with Mobius
What's next? Let's talk!